Understanding the USA Healthcare Recruitment Landscape for Kenyans
The United States healthcare system is a complex, highly regulated environment. For professionals in Kenya aiming to break into this market, grasping the specific requirements is paramount. This includes understanding visa sponsorships, licensing equivalencies, and the types of institutions actively seeking international talent. Many US hospitals and healthcare facilities operate through specialized recruitment agencies or directly engage with overseas talent pools. Building connections within these networks often requires demonstrating not only clinical expertise but also cultural adaptability and a clear understanding of US healthcare practices. Navigating this requires diligent research and strategic networking, ensuring your qualifications meet the stringent standards expected.

Cost Considerations and Strategic Planning for International Moves
Embarking on an international career move involves financial planning. While direct recruitment fees for international healthcare professionals can vary widely, potential costs include visa application fees, licensing exams, and initial relocation expenses. Some employers may offer sponsorship packages covering these, while others expect candidates to bear them. It's crucial to clarify these details early. For instance, initial licensing exam fees could range from KES 30,000 to KES 100,000, depending on the profession and state. Understanding these potential outlays, alongside your salary expectations, is key to a successful transition. Thorough research into potential employers and their support structures can prevent unexpected financial burdens.
